One category that seems genuinely useful is agents that help reason about complex systems rather than directly execute tasks. For example, I’ve been experimenting with a small tool that takes a description of an AI product and decomposes it into tasks, estimates token usage, and models the cost implications of different architectures. It’s not an autonomous agent, but it’s been surprisingly useful as a “thinking tool” before building something. |
